Centos7 连接外部网络

最近准备准备安装虚拟机搭建集群,安装完Centos7碰到了无法连接外部网络的问题,一番百度之后问题解决,记录一下步骤,一共四个步骤。

1. 查看本机的ip地址以及DNS服务器地址

1)Win+R打开运行界面输入cmd,打开命令行。

2)命令行输入ipconfig /all查看ip和dns。IP地址我们使用VMnet8,DNS使用WLAN。

2. 修改虚拟网络配置

1)打开VMWare workstation, 选择编辑->虚拟网络编辑器

2)选择VMnet8 NAT模式, 点击更改设置,允许更改配置,再次打开虚拟网络编辑器页面,就可以编辑VMnet8了,这个不要选择使用本地DHCP服务将IP地址分配给虚拟机。

3)点击NAT设置,设置NAT,获取网关,这个网关地址之后会被配置在服务器中。点击确定,即完成设置。

3. 修改操作系统网络配置

1)启动服务器,切换为root角色。

2)修改网络配置,输入命令vi /etc/sysconfig/network-scripts/ifcfg-ens33 修改ifcfg-ens33这个文件,修改后保存退出。

TYPE=Ethernet
BOOTPROTO=static  #设置静态Ip
DEFROUTE=yes
IPV4_FAILURE_FATAL=no
IPV6INIT=yes
IPV6_AUTOCONF=yes
IPV6_DEFROUTE=yes
IPV6_FAILURE_FATAL=no
NAME=eno16777736
UUID=4f40dedc-031b-4b72-ad4d-ef4721947439
DEVICE=eno16777736
ONBOOT=yes  #这里如果为no的话就改为yes,表示网卡设备自动启动
PEERDNS=yes
PEERROUTES=yes
IPV6_PEERDNS=yes
IPV6_PEERROUTES=yes
IPV6_PRIVACY=no

GATEWAY=192.168.6.2  #这里的网关地址就是第二步获取到的那个网关地址
IPADDR=192.168.6.10  #配置ip,在第二步已经设置ip处于192.168.6.xxx这个范围,我就随便设为10了,只要不和网关相同均可
NETMASK=255.255.255.0 #子网掩码
DNS1=192.168.0.1 #dns服务器1,填写第一步获取的DNS地址即可

4. 重启网络服务,测试是否连接外部网络成功。

1)输入service network restart

2)ping www.baidu.com 测试是否能访问百度。连接成功。

 

  • 2
    点赞
  • 15
    收藏
    觉得还不错? 一键收藏
  • 1
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论 1
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值